**14:32** — Compaction on the Drossel message queue at Vantermere Systems began reclaiming segments still referenced by the Opaline consumer group. The root cause, as you'll see later in this document, was a retention offset computed before the consumer checkpoint flushed. At this point operators paused compaction on brokers three and five, preserving the remaining segments for recovery. Note for new contractors: always capture broker state before resuming compaction. The affected brokers were running the build recorded immediately below.

session token of hawif-bajog = htk6_9ab8da

TURN-208: Gatevale turnstile counters at the Merrow Field pilot double-count when a rotation reverses mid-cycle. Attendance totals drift roughly 2% high per event. The debounce window fix is implemented, reviewed by Ilsa, and soak-tested across two simulated match days without drift. Ready for your cut; the candidate build is identified below.

trace token, tagag-tafog: htk6_5ed18c

### 2.3.0 — Job Queue Replacement

The homegrown Ashvale job queue has been replaced with the vetted Corvid broker. Security-relevant changes: payloads are now signed before enqueue, dead-letter contents are encrypted at rest, and worker credentials rotate daily. The old queue's shared-secret scheme is fully retired. Reviewers should verify the key-rotation config before approving rollout. The migration was carried out under one accountable owner.

named custodian: Brivan Eliath Quenox Frador

Leadership Review Briefing: Annual Insurance Renewal

For heads of department. Our property and liability coverage with Thornbury Mutual renews at quarter end. Premiums are quoted 9% higher, reflecting last year's warehouse claim at the Gellworth site. Risk has negotiated a higher deductible to offset part of the increase. A decision is required at Thursday's review. Relevant planning considerations appear in the note below.

management briefing: Project Ulavan slips by two quarters because of the staffing delay.